The Crabby Oyster is a restaurant located in Seaside, OR. It is one of 92 restaurants listed in Seaside. Its 4.0-star rating is slightly below the Seaside city average of 4.3 stars. It ranks #13 of 92 restaurants in Seaside. There are 10 photos associated with this location.

★★★★☆ 4.0 Doug Davis (Shath) · Jun 2025

The food was decent but not great. I had a burger that didn't taste bad but also didn't have a ton of seasoning. The fries actually had more seasoning and were cooked well. The bun was toasted really nicely though. My wife had the shrimp tacos with onion rings. The shrimp was cooked well and well seasoned. The cilantro lime sauce was delicious. The only thing she didn't like was the amount of cabbage on the tacos. The onion rings were crisp and seasoned well. Our waiter was struggling a bit. When we were finished we were waiting for about 10-15 for our bill. Overall the experience wasn't bad but I probably wouldn't go back again, due to the variety of other options in the area.
